Synonym: (2R)-2,4-Dihydroxy-N-[3-[(2-mercaptoethyl)amino]-3-oxopropyl]-3,3-dimethylbutanamide; (R)-2,4-Dihydroxy-N-[2-[(2-mercaptoethyl)carbamoyl]ethyl]-3,3-dimethylbutyramide; (D)-(+)-Pantetheine; N-(Pantothenyl)-β-aminoethanethiol; LBF; Lactobacillus bulgaricus factor
CAS Number: 496-65-1
Empirical Formula (Hill Notation): C11H22N2O4S
Molecular Weight: 278.37
MDL Number: MFCD00056757
Linear Formula: C11H22N2O4S
